Quote from shawy89 on September 6, 2011, 11:49 pmHi, I'm currently making my first Portal 2 map and could use some help.
For part of my puzzle, I need to use a 'Portal Cleanser', an Emancipation Grill that doesn't destroy cubes. Now, I know full-well how to make this, but I can't seem to find a good texture to use that makes it obvious to the player that it won't fizzle their cube.
I've got a good few regular grills in my map that DO fizzle cubes so I need to differentiate between the 2. Also, I really can't make it invisible as I think for this puzzle the player really need to be aware they're losing their portals. It's not just between rooms, it's mid-puzzle.
I've seen a map that used the Portal 1 style emancipation grills, I think that would be good but I cannot find it. Or can anyone suggest anything else?
Any help appreciated, thanks.

Quote from spongylover123 on September 7, 2011, 12:08 am1) for TRIGGER_PORTAL_CLEANSER fizzling portals and NOT cubes is to uncheck "PHYSICS OBJECTS" in the FLAGS sections
2)different textures for the portal cleanser is to just use a trigger texture,
(remember the test chamber with the companion cube and to get an achievement to bring the companion cube to the elevator, but the companion cube gets fizzled when in the elevator? Well, VALVE used an invisible texture to only destroy cubes)
In other words you can use any texture for the TRIGGER_PORTAL_CLEANSER if you can pass through it (e.g invisible or trigger)Portal 1 version of emacipation grills?
Check and try this:
http://developer.valvesoftware.com/wiki ... ct_fizzler
I think it still worksHope this helps

Quote from iWork925 on September 7, 2011, 9:11 amYou seemto have only just skimmed over his post. He knows how to create it, he needs help implementing it into his puzzle.
My suggestion would to have a normal fizzler and a hole next to it only just big enough for the cube, say 32x32. The player can put the cube through the hole (so it's not fizzled) and walk through the fizzled and the portals are cleansed. I HIGHLY recommend NOT creating invisible or portal only fizzles as it will confuse the player. It also looks cheap and nasty.
